Former Vice President and 2020 White House hopeful Joe Biden on Monday said that under his new health care plan, people who like their insurance coverage won’t be forced to give it up.

The Hill reports Biden told an audience at the AARP presidential forum in Iowa the “Medicare for All” option, being pushed by Sens. Bernie Sanders and Elizabeth Warren, is “risky.”

He even dared to echo the infamous line by former President Obama, who repeatedly said "if you like your health care plan, you can keep it." 

PolitiFact called that line the "Lie of the Year" in 2013.

Still, Biden said Monday “If you like your health care plan, your employer-based plan, you can keep it.” Biden is running on protecting ObamaCare.
